Wactaw Thomas Pytlewski 1923 - 2007

Wactaw Thomas Pytlewski of Gaylord, Otsego County, MI was born on October 21, 1923, and died at age 83 years old on October 19, 2007. Wactaw Pytlewski was buried at Ft. Custer National Cemetery Section P3 Site 191 15501 Dickman Road - No. Entrance Svc Maintenance Bldg, in Augusta.

In 1923, in the year that Wactaw Thomas Pytlewski was born, the A.C. Nielsen Company was founded in Chicago. It provided an audience measurement system that could provide radio station owners with information on their listeners and the popularity of their shows. Later, the Nielsen company became the basis for the fate of television programs.

In 1951, Wactaw was 28 years old when on February 27th, the 22nd Amendment to the US Constitution (which limited the number of terms a president may serve to two) was ratified by 36 states, making it a part of the U.S. Constitution. The Amendment was both a reaction to the 4 term Roosevelt presidency and also the recognition of a long-standing tradition in American politics.
